Output ef20ec63de7a0a573089a64b24b7cd2f4d24eb355ce29ea3668356ba0079c8e4:2

value
39241
script pubkey
OP_0 OP_PUSHBYTES_20 6f842e18fa0d753949339f2ac46737f8e557ba5b
address
bc1qd7zzux86p46njjfnnu4vgeehlrj40wjm3eaz5r
transaction
ef20ec63de7a0a573089a64b24b7cd2f4d24eb355ce29ea3668356ba0079c8e4
confirmations
13750
spent
true